Doxycycline and hexafluoroisopropanol (HFIP) were also acquired from Sigma-Aldrich. WebO and the molecular weight is 1025.89. Doxycycline is a light-yellow crystalline powder. Doxycycline hyclate is soluble in water, while doxycycline monohydrate is very slightly soluble in water. Doxycycline has a high degree of lipoid solubility and a low affinity for calcium binding. It is highly stable in normal human serum.
WebAug 2, 2024 · Also, the molecular weight of doxycycline monohydrate is about half that of doxycycline hyclate. Another difference, according to the pharmaceutical manufacturer Pfizer, is the hyclate variation is water-soluble, while monohydrate is only “very slightly soluble in water.”

Doxycycline is a broad-spectrum antibiotic of the tetracycline class used in the treatment of infections caused by bacteria and certain parasites. [1] It is used to treat bacterial pneumonia, acne, chlamydia infections, Lyme disease, cholera, typhus, and syphilis. [1] It is also used to prevent malaria in combination with quinine.
